I'm Ryan Ary, and in case you missed it, at a Disney marketing expo in Shanghai, Marvel unveiled a light show for Avengers Doomsday. This is not an official trailer, but it offers plot elements and clues.

Despite initial skepticism about the film featuring Robert Downey Jr. as Dr. Doom, early concept art and scenes have sparked excitement. The storyline potentially revolves around a Tony Stark variant that survives the Infinity War snap, keeping the stones and becoming Dr. Doom after a multiverse event destroys his universe.

The teaser, part of a mind-blowing light display, suggests Doom is trying to stabilize the multiverse for control. The imagery includes Doom's use of time travel technology and parallels with the TVA's narrative seen in the series Loki. This aligns with Dr. Doom's comic book history where he controls realities as God Emperor Doom.

The discussion suggests influences from the 2015 Secret Wars comic, a major Marvel storyline where Doom creates a Battle World, combining realities. Elements of the teaser align with this story, hinting at a multiversal conflict involving Marvel heroes and variants.

The breakdown also hints that Doom will display tremendous power, potentially defeating major characters like Thanos to establish his dominance, creating a 'suit of armor' around the multiverse. This reflects Tony Stark's transformation into Doom, a godlike being wielding reality's power.

Overall, the teaser hints at a narrative evolution in the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U), with significant implications for future storylines involving crossover and multiverse themes.
